I have consulted with developers and there are two ways to resolve this case:

1. Upgrade Parallels Plesk Sitebuilder to latest 4.5 release, re-publish the entire site and issue should be automatically resolved. This way is more preferable as some other issue from version 4.2 will be also resolved.
2. Create a support ticket with the reference to this thread so we could pass it to developers for investigation.
